Happy Valley Another Level 3.5g
HybridTHC: 31.87%TAC: 34.88 %Terps: 1.95%
End Game #3 x GMO Zkittlez
Another Level was certainly a standout in our initial round of breeding. We took Happy Valley’s keeper pheno of GMO Zkittlez which was selected in 2022 from a pheno hunt of over 100 plants. This GMO Zkittlez pheno took 1st Place in the 2022 Cultivators Cup Solventless Rosin Cart category for its garlic, mushroom, and onion nose with hints of Zkittlez. When we crossed GMOZ with Ethos’s Endgame #3 clone, the resulting hybrid was truly on “Another Level”. The flowers on this hybrid have excellent trichome coverage, nice dense buds and some gorgeous hues of violet. Expect a strong experience with flavors ranging from funky to fruity.

LimoneneLimonene is found in citrus rinds and is the second most commonly occurring terpene in nature. This terpene has been used in high dosages as a catalyst in topical products to allow other chemical compounds to pass through the skin for absorption in the blood.

Beta CaryophylleneBeta-caryophyllene is known for it's wide variety of potential health benefits both physically & mentally. This terpene has a unique ability to bind to the CB2 receptors; CB2 receptors are targeted when treating pain & inflammation with cannabis. Beta-caryophyllene is also approved for use in food by the FDA & is commonly found in black pepper, cinnamon, & basil.

Alpha PineneA commonly found terpene in cannabis, Alpha-pinene lends it's name to it's easily recognized signature scent, that of pine trees. Alpha-pinene is already being used in plants to limit the growth of undesired bacteria as it is the most commonly found terpene in nature. Many users report a boost of energy or brain function when consuming a cannabis product high in Alpha-pinene.
